The focus of Family and Consumer Sciences is to enhance the skills and knowledge that will promote the well-being of individuals, families, and communities. Our programs and profession focus on individuals and families in order to achieve an optimum balance between people and their environments. The mission of Family and Consumer Sciences is to empower individuals and families to function interdependently in a global society.

Special Features

  • Faculty in Family and Consumer Sciences come from diverse educational backgrounds and expertise. Faculty members promote and integrate a holistic approach to understanding individuals and families while preparing students for professional careers or graduate study.
  • The Department is equipped with state of the art laboratories for textiles, food, and teacher credentialing preparation courses.
  • The Didactic Program in Dietetics (DPD) and the Nutrition and Dietetics Internship (NDI) programs are accredited by the Accreditation Council for Education in Nutrition and Dietetics (ACEND); the Family Studies program is approved by the National Council on Family Relations; and the Pre-Credential Single Subject Matter program is approved by the California Commission on Teacher Credentialing.
  • Through its internship program, the Department provides an opportunity for students to work under the supervision of a professional in business, education, government, or public service settings. Internships (FACS 195C) are planned in advance with an advisor.
  • The Department sponsors three student organizations for students to participate in several professional organizations related to their major concentrations.
